Title

THE RESILIENCE ATTITUDE TOWARDS ONLINE SHOPPING WITH SPECIAL REFERENCE TO DINDIGUL CITY MUNCIPAL CORPORATION

Abstract

Due to abundant business opportunities, there are a number of services being offered online. Online shopping has emerged as one of the most prominent opportunities available through internet. It has enormous advantages for the customers as well as business houses. Through online shopping, business houses are able to reach out to more customers at limited cost in rural areas. In fact, they act as a stepping-stone to the concept of global village. Hence, online shopping provides unlimited choices to the customers in a nutshell. The customer can shop any day of the year at any time of the day. This also helps in customers‟ time and energy saving. Moreover, due to unlimited choice and less excess time, customers can easily search for the desired things and can easily compare the products/items. This paper attempts to find out the resilience attitude towards online shopping with special reference to Dindigul City Municipal Corporation. A survey was conducted among 160 respondents on the basis of random sampling method. Reliability testing has been conducted to measure the consistency of results and ensure that items or measures are error free. SPSS Software is used to analyze the data and get output. Annova, Mann-Whitney Test, Kruskal-Wallis Test, Two-Sample Kolmogorov-Smirnov Test and Multiple regression analysis have been used to identify about the demographic factors with buying portals of customer towards online shopping and Resilience attitude of Online Shopping.
